2020-06-21 19:24:14 +00:00
|
|
|
package com.vanced.manager.core
|
|
|
|
|
|
|
|
import android.app.Application
|
2020-07-06 11:38:00 +00:00
|
|
|
import android.content.res.Configuration
|
|
|
|
import com.crowdin.platform.Crowdin
|
|
|
|
import com.crowdin.platform.CrowdinConfig
|
|
|
|
import com.crowdin.platform.data.remote.NetworkType
|
2020-06-21 19:24:14 +00:00
|
|
|
import com.downloader.PRDownloader
|
2020-06-28 18:23:33 +00:00
|
|
|
import com.vanced.manager.utils.NotificationHelper.createNotifChannel
|
2020-06-21 19:24:14 +00:00
|
|
|
|
|
|
|
class App: Application() {
|
|
|
|
|
|
|
|
override fun onCreate() {
|
|
|
|
super.onCreate()
|
2020-07-04 16:36:59 +00:00
|
|
|
PRDownloader.initialize(this)
|
2020-06-28 18:23:33 +00:00
|
|
|
createNotifChannel(this)
|
2020-07-06 11:38:00 +00:00
|
|
|
|
|
|
|
Crowdin.init(this,
|
|
|
|
CrowdinConfig.Builder()
|
|
|
|
.withDistributionHash("36c51aed3180a4f43073d28j4s6")
|
|
|
|
.withNetworkType(NetworkType.WIFI)
|
|
|
|
.build())
|
|
|
|
}
|
|
|
|
|
|
|
|
override fun onConfigurationChanged(newConfig: Configuration) {
|
|
|
|
super.onConfigurationChanged(newConfig)
|
|
|
|
Crowdin.onConfigurationChanged()
|
2020-06-21 19:24:14 +00:00
|
|
|
}
|
|
|
|
|
|
|
|
}
|